A gender reveal ultrasound is a special sonographic procedure performed during pregnancy, typically between 18 to 22 weeks, to determine the sex of the unborn baby. This non-invasive scan allows expectant parents to see their baby’s form and movements in real time, creating a unique and emotional moment. Beyond its primary function of revealing the baby’s gender, this ultrasound can also offer an early glimpse into the baby’s health and development. The session is usually a celebratory event, often shared with family and close friends, making it a cherished milestone in the pregnancy journey. It marks a pivotal point where the baby’s identity begins to take on a more concrete shape in the parents’ minds, often influencing names, nursery themes, and dreams for the future.
The capability to detect a baby’s gender using ultrasound technology generally becomes possible from as early as 14 weeks gestation, but it is more commonly performed between 18 to 22 weeks for higher accuracy. During this period, genital differentiation is clearer, and the sonographer can more confidently identify male or female anatomical features. However, the precision of gender determination also heavily depends on the position of the baby during the ultrasound scan, as well as the technician’s experience. Some advanced ultrasound techniques and equipment can offer glimpses into the baby’s gender slightly earlier, with varying degrees of certainty. Expectant parents need to remember that while gender reveal ultrasounds provide exciting moments, the priority of any ultrasound is to assess the health and development of the fetus.
The benefits of a gender reveal ultrasound extend beyond merely learning the sex of the unborn baby; they provide a profound, emotionally enriching experience for expectant parents. This special ultrasound serves as a pivotal moment in the pregnancy, fostering a deeper connection between the parents and the baby. With the reveal of the baby’s gender, parents often find themselves more engaged in the pregnancy, envisioning their future and starting to form a unique bond with their child. This moment can also enhance familial bonds, as it offers a shared experience for family members and close friends, often serving as a celebration that brings loved ones closer together. Additionally, knowing the baby’s gender can aid in practical preparations, such as choosing a name, decorating a nursery, and selecting gender-specific clothes and toys. Beyond the emotional and social benefits, having a gender reveal ultrasound can provide reassurance and peace of mind, affirming the ongoing health and development of the baby through visual confirmation of growth and activity.
The accuracy of gender reveal ultrasounds has become remarkably high, particularly when conducted between 18 to 22 weeks of gestation, reaching accuracy rates upwards of 90-95%. These figures, however, can significantly depend on several factors such as the fetus’s position during the ultrasound, the experience level of the sonographer, and the quality of the ultrasound equipment used. While advances in ultrasound technology have improved the clarity and reliability of prenatal images, it’s essential to note that certain conditions, like the baby’s uncooperative position (such as crossed legs), may obscure clear identification of gender-specific anatomical features. Additionally, ultrasounds performed earlier than 18 weeks may yield less accurate results due to incomplete development of external genitalia. Despite the highly accurate outcomes in many cases, expectant parents need to understand that no gender determination via ultrasound can be guaranteed 100% accurate until the baby is born.
